Ambulatory surgical centers (ASCs) are medical facilities that provide same-day surgical care, including diagnostic and preventive procedures. ASCs offer various benefits such as lower costs, shorter wait times for procedures, and more flexible hours of operation compared to hospital outpatient departments. There is growing demand for ASCs due to advancement in minimally invasive surgeries and rising prevalence of chronic diseases. This allows more procedures to be performed outside hospitals in an affordable manner. Market Opportunity:

Streamlining outpatient procedures presents a key opportunity in the ambulatory surgical center market. Growing emphasis on cost-efficient healthcare is driving the transition of lower-risk surgeries and procedures from hospitals to ASCs. ASCs allow for procedures like endoscopy, cataract removal etc. to be performed without requiring overnight hospital stay. This improves affordability and availability of surgeries for patients. It also eases burden on hospitals enabling them to focus resources on complex cases. Porter’s Analysis

Threat of new entrants: The ambulatory surgical center market experiences moderate threat from new entrants as it requires high initial investments to setup medical facilities and obtain regulatory approvals.

Bargaining power of buyers: The bargaining power of buyers is moderate as customers have few alternatives for ambulatory surgical centers and are sensitive to out of pocket medical costs.

Bargaining power of suppliers: Medical device suppliers and pharma companies supplying drugs to ambulatory surgical centers hold significant bargaining power due to their specialized offerings and technologies.

Threat of new substitutes: Potential substitutes include inpatient hospital care, but ambulatory surgical centers provide convenience and lower costs.

Competitive rivalry: High due to large number of players competing on service quality, technological integration, and price.

 

SWOT Analysis

Strengths: Convenience of services, lower costs compared to hospitals, minimize hospital stays and quicker recovery.

Weaknesses: Heavy investment needs, complex regulatory approvals and quality certifications to adhere to. Shortage of specialized medical staff.

Opportunities: Growing geriatric population prone to surgeries, rise in diagnostic and preventive care seeking, expansion to rural regions.

Threats: Economic downturns affect discretionary spend on surgeries, policy changes impacting reimbursement rates.
